Community listening session following IQA World Cup 2025

Feb 5, 2026 | Announcement, trustees, World Cup

The IQA Board of Trustees is opening the next step in our accountability and learning process for IQA World Cup 2025: community listening session.

While the feedback form managed by the Events Department remains an important tool for collecting written input, we recognize that some reflections require dialogue. These listening sessions are designed to provide a structured, respectful space for participants to share experiences, perspectives, and lessons learned directly with Trustees.

The sessions will focus on reflection and collective learning. They are intended to better understand their impact and to help inform stronger processes, standards, and communication for future international events.

Participation is optional and open to individuals who took part in the IQA World Cup 2025, including players, volunteers, officials, and national representatives. To help us organize sessions effectively, interested participants are asked to complete a short participation form here.

Feedback gathered through these sessions will be synthesized with written internal recommendations that will guide future decision-making that will be shared with our NGBs.
